Как открыть файл JAR на Android
Ваше устройство Android может запускать игры и приложения Java, но оно не предназначено для этого, и, следовательно, вы не найдете эмуляторов Java в Play Store для запуска файлов jar на устройствах Android.
Однако, если вам необходимо открыть файл jar на своем устройстве Android, есть несколько сторонних приложений, которые вы можете установить на свое устройство Android для запуска приложений Java и игр. Но знай, что вам нужен root-доступ на вашем Android-устройстве для запуска Java.
В наших тестах мы обнаружили, что приложение JBED является лучшим из всех для открытия файлов jar на устройствах Android. По сути, это эмулятор JAVA, который вы можете использовать для установки приложений и игр JAR / JAD / JAVA / J2ME / MIDP на ваше устройство Android.
[icon name=”download” unprefixed_class=””] Скачать JBED (.apk)
[icon name=”download” unprefixed_class=””] Скачать libjbedvm.so
Программы для Windows, мобильные приложения, игры — ВСЁ БЕСПЛАТНО, в нашем закрытом телеграмм канале — Подписывайтесь:)
инструкции
- Загрузите как JBED.apk а также libjbedvm.so файлы на ваше устройство по ссылкам для скачивания выше.
- Используя приложение файлового менеджера с root-доступом, поместите файл libjbedvm.so в каталог system / lib на вашем устройстве Android.
- Установите файл JBED.apk на вашем устройстве. НО ЕЩЕ НЕ ОТКРЫВАЙТЕ!
- Перезагрузите ваше устройство.
- Откройте приложение JBED »откройте меню и выберите SD-карта» выберите файл jar / jad, который хотите открыть, и установите его.
- Теперь откройте установленное вами приложение Java.
Это все. Надеюсь, вы сможете открывать файлы jar на устройстве Android, следуя приведенному выше руководству.
Лучшие эмуляторы для Java-игр на Android
Многие знают, что существуют множество языков программирования, благодаря которым пишутся разные программы и игры в том числе. Особую популярность в России снискали игры на языке программирования J2ME (или же, если расшифровывать, Java 2 Mirco Edition). Второе их название — Мидлеты (произошло от английского MIDlets). В основном их устанавливают через WAP (хотя стоит сказать, что в нынешнее время есть множество других способов установки приложений).
Что такое Java-игры
Что же такого хорошего в Java-играх, что они до сих пор популярны? Все современные смартфоны имеют поддержку J2ME, также все Java-игры максимально портативны. Они портативны настолько, что их можно сотнями скачивать на свой телефон. Каждый человек рано или поздно сталкивается с тем, что ему нечем занять своё время. Например поездки в метро, ожидание в очереди, пробки и т.д. Скаченные на телефон Java-игры прекрасно справляются с убийством времени. Некоторые из игр (например головоломки) не только убивают время, но ещё и помогают человеку развиваться (или не забывать уже изученные знания).
На данный момент имеются тысячи разных Java-игр, начиная от обычных аркад и головоломок, заканчивая стратегиями и эротическими играми. Для каждого найдётся своя игра по душе. Технологии не стоят на месте, потому стали появляться игры в 3D Java-игры, что положительно сказывается на их репутации самой индустрии таких игр.
- Bounce.
Мало кто сможет забыть этот симулятор красного шара. Добраться до конца уровня и при этом не попасть на шипы и не упасть куда-либо — вот вся цель этой игры. Bounce притягивала своей простатой в дизайне и сложностью в геймплее. Любой, у кого был кнопочный телефон, скорее всего с ностальгией вспомнит этот красный шарик (ну и коды для него, разумеется, ведь не все могли пройти уровни честно). - Doom RPG
Все, кому сейчас за 30 лет с приятной ностальгией вспоминают первый Doom, который был просто хитом в 90-е годы. А теперь представьте, что вместо шутера, где нужно бегать и стрелять, вы получаете пошаговую Рпг с той же графикой и теми же особенностями (множество секретных комнат, пасхальных яиц и т.д.). На телефон игра была просто бесподобна и тысячи людей тратили своё драгоценное время на то, чтобы порубить в старый-добрый Doom в формате РПГ. - Worms
Если вы не играли в червячков, которые стреляют из РПГ и прочего оружия — у вас не было детства. Ведь каждый школьник в начале нулевых показывал своё мастерство именно игрой в червячки. А когда все поняли, что через Bluetooth можно играть вместе со своими друзьями — тогда игра окончательно поработила юные умы. Это как раз тот тип игр, которые запоминаются на многие годы.
Если же вас одолела ностальгия по старым временам и хочется снова окунуться в мир нулевых с Java-играми, то специально для вас были придуманы Java-эмуляторы на Андроид, благодаря которым вы сможете на своём смартфоне поиграть в старые-добрые червячки. Или же вновь пройти всю игру за красного шарика.
Чем открыть jar на андроиде
Сегодня речь пойдет о том, как запускать полноценные java-приложения на устройствах под управлением Android, для чего это может быть необходимо и какие приложения будут актуальны для мобильной платформы. Полноценные приложения это те, для запуска которых не хватает возможностей Dalvik VM. Таким приложениям необходима JRE. Далее поговорим о том, как ее установить и работать с ней.
Установка
Для установки JRE требуется установить какой-нибудь terminal и busybox. Последний пакет требует наличия root-прав. О том, как получить root-права для Android можно прочесть здесь. Сама JRE не требует root. Скачать приложение можно из основного репозитория альтернативного маркета F-droid, либо самостоятельно собрать пакет из исходного кода. Сам процесс установки тривиален, все как и для любого другого apk-файла. После запуска программы она предложит докачать дополнительные библиотеки (glibc, awt и т.д.). Кстати, все зависимости, вроде терминала и busybox программа также способна скачать самостоятельно. Разумеется, для максимальной совместимости необходимо отметить все элементы.
Использование
Для запуска jar-архива нажимаем на кнопку «run jar file», программа запрашивает доступ к файловой системе. Выбираем программу, с помощью которой указываем файл для запуска.
Лично я рекомендую Total Commander в качестве файлового менеджера. Он бесплатен и очень удобен, плюс есть поддержка плагинов.
Так вот, после выбора файла открывается окно терминала, который запускает java-машину и передает ей путь к выбранному jar-файлу. Далее, в зависимости от программы, работа будет через терминал, либо запустится отрисовка интерфейса. Очень легко и удобно, не правда ли? К сожалению, есть небольшой косметический недочет, при первом запуске в терминале криво отображается путь к исполняемому файлу java и передаваемым аргументам.
Но на работу это не влияет, а при повторном запуске команды она отображается правильно.
На рисунке результат запуска небольшого тестового проекта. Его код приведен ниже
Что касается GUI-приложений, то мой AExplorer отказался запускаться, ссылаясь на отсутствие поддержки в текущих версиях.
Тем не менее, «полноценные» консольные приложения работают без особых проблем.
Итоги
Не смотря на очевидные недоработки в запуске оконных приложений, на сегодняшний день уже возможно запускать консольные java-приложения. Они работают без каких-либо проблем, если не используют каких-либо дополнительных нативных библиотек. В таком случае необходимо сначала собрать библиотеку на устройстве, а уже потом запускать jar-архив. Тем не менее, java installer на сегодняшний день вполне жизнеспособный проект.